This may seem like a bad sign for the city’s broader condo market, but the larger picture is more complex. The luxury market in Philly is relatively small, especially compared to cities like New York or Miami. Also, recent spikes in interest rates and pandemic era crises caused a retreat of some suburban buyers from Philly’s already small market.
There might be less high-end buyers, but those few are willing to spend millions. By certain measures, like sale prices, Philly’s luxury condo market is healthier than it has ever been..
